Crawlspace waterproofing services involve the installation of systems designed to keep the area beneath a building dry and free from excess moisture. These services typically include applying vapor barriers, sealing foundation cracks, and installing drainage systems such as sump pumps or interior drains. The goal is to prevent water intrusion from rain, groundwater, or plumbing leaks, thereby reducing the risk of water damage and mold growth. Proper waterproofing helps maintain a stable environment in the crawlspace, which can contribute to the overall health of the property.
Water intrusion in crawlspaces can lead to a variety of problems, including wood rot, mold development, and structural deterioration. Excess moisture can also create an environment conducive to pests like termites and rodents. By addressing these issues proactively through waterproofing, property owners can mitigate potential damage and avoid costly repairs in the future. Additionally, controlling humidity levels in the crawlspace can improve indoor air quality and prevent musty odors from permeating the living areas above.

Labor Costs - The cost of labor for crawlspace waterproofing typically ranges from $500 to $2,500, depending on the size of the area and complexity of the job. Larger or more complex projects may be on the higher end of this range.
Material Expenses - Materials such as vapor barriers, sump pumps, and sealants generally cost between $300 and $1,200. The total depends on the scope and quality of the materials chosen by local service providers.
Total Project Cost - Overall costs for crawlspace waterproofing services usually fall between $1,000 and $5,000. Factors influencing the total include project size, materials used, and local labor rates.
Additional Fees - Extra expenses may include permits or structural repairs, which can add $200 to $1,000 or more. These costs vary based on specific project requirements and local regulations.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is crawlspace waterproofing? Crawlspace waterproofing involves measures to prevent water intrusion and moisture buildup in the crawlspace area, helping to protect the home’s foundation and indoor air quality.
Why should I consider crawlspace waterproofing? Waterproofing can help reduce issues like mold growth, wood rot, and structural damage caused by excess moisture in the crawlspace.
What methods are used in crawlspace waterproofing? Local service providers may use techniques such as installing vapor barriers, sealing cracks, and applying exterior waterproof coatings to manage moisture.
How do I know if my crawlspace needs waterproofing? Signs include persistent dampness, mold or mildew presence, musty odors, and visible water stains or damage in the crawlspace area.
